These identities of the deity are juxtaposed, both conceived as a child and God, great and small, and an unknowable entity and an intimate lover. It is also noted for its description of the deity's 142:. The hymn is composed in a number of poetic metres, expressive of the themes of faith and the philosophical idealisation of the deity.
